1.Inoculating holding medium kept at refrigeration temperature at about 4-5 C as to increase the shelf life of media. 2.Ferrous sulfate is added as it is Indicator of H2S formation which means the black color of ferrous sulfide is seen. 3.Vitamin K1 -support the growth of fastidious anaerobes, especially Bacteroides, Prevotella, and Porphyromonas when incubated anaerobically,it is used for the isolation of strict anaerobes from clinical specimens and used for susceptibility testing of anaerobes with the E test method.
